describe "#matches?" do
context "when the protected branch setting is not a wildcard" do
let(:protected_branch) { build(:protected_branch, name: "production/some-branch") }
it "returns true for branch names that are an exact match" do
expect(protected_branch.matches?("production/some-branch")).to be true
end
it "returns false for branch names that are not an exact match" do
expect(protected_branch.matches?("staging/some-branch")).to be false
end
end
context "when the protected branch name contains wildcard(s)" do
context "when there is a single '*'" do
let(:protected_branch) { build(:protected_branch, name: "production/*") }
it "returns true for branch names matching the wildcard" do
expect(protected_branch.matches?("production/some-branch")).to be true
expect(protected_branch.matches?("production/")).to be true
end
it "returns false for branch names not matching the wildcard" do
expect(protected_branch.matches?("staging/some-branch")).to be false
expect(protected_branch.matches?("production")).to be false
end
end
context "when the wildcard contains regex symbols other than a '*'" do
let(:protected_branch) { build(:protected_branch, name: "pro.duc.tion/*") }
it "returns true for branch names matching the wildcard" do
expect(protected_branch.matches?("pro.duc.tion/some-branch")).to be true
end
it "returns false for branch names not matching the wildcard" do
expect(protected_branch.matches?("production/some-branch")).to be false
expect(protected_branch.matches?("proXducYtion/some-branch")).to be false
end
end
context "when there are '*'s at either end" do
let(:protected_branch) { build(:protected_branch, name: "*/production/*") }
it "returns true for branch names matching the wildcard" do
expect(protected_branch.matches?("gitlab/production/some-branch")).to be true
expect(protected_branch.matches?("/production/some-branch")).to be true
expect(protected_branch.matches?("gitlab/production/")).to be true
expect(protected_branch.matches?("/production/")).to be true
end
it "returns false for branch names not matching the wildcard" do
expect(protected_branch.matches?("gitlabproductionsome-branch")).to be false
expect(protected_branch.matches?("production/some-branch")).to be false
expect(protected_branch.matches?("gitlab/production")).to be false
expect(protected_branch.matches?("production")).to be false
end
end
context "when there are arbitrarily placed '*'s" do
let(:protected_branch) { build(:protected_branch, name: "pro*duction/*/gitlab/*") }
it "returns true for branch names matching the wildcard" do
expect(protected_branch.matches?("production/some-branch/gitlab/second-branch")).to be true
expect(protected_branch.matches?("proXYZduction/some-branch/gitlab/second-branch")).to be true
expect(protected_branch.matches?("proXYZduction/gitlab/gitlab/gitlab")).to be true
expect(protected_branch.matches?("proXYZduction//gitlab/")).to be true
expect(protected_branch.matches?("proXYZduction/some-branch/gitlab/")).to be true
expect(protected_branch.matches?("proXYZduction//gitlab/some-branch")).to be true
end
it "returns false for branch names not matching the wildcard" do
expect(protected_branch.matches?("production/some-branch/not-gitlab/second-branch")).to be false
expect(protected_branch.matches?("prodXYZuction/some-branch/gitlab/second-branch")).to be false
expect(protected_branch.matches?("proXYZduction/gitlab/some-branch/gitlab")).to be false
expect(protected_branch.matches?("proXYZduction/gitlab//")).to be false
expect(protected_branch.matches?("proXYZduction/gitlab/")).to be false
expect(protected_branch.matches?("proXYZduction//some-branch/gitlab")).to be false
end
end
end
end
